Process
You'll need to understand how to repair glass when you've recently cracked the windshield of your car, chipped your car's window, or broken windows. To get the most effective results, your window or glass will require cleaning prior to the repair process beginning. To avoid any serious damage to your vehicle, experts in glass repair will also wash the chipped areas. After cleaning the area, loose shards are removed and vacuumed to eliminate air pressures. Glass repair specialists apply a specially-formulated resin to the damaged area. The glass repair specialist will then fix the chip or crack with an adhesive. Once the resin is dried, it is ready to be placed.

Toughened glass is another type of glass used to repair. Toughened glass begins as floating glass, and then is treated with heat and then shock-cooled. It is resistant to breakage and prevents it separating into numerous pieces. It is extremely difficult to cut and drill. Toughened glass is more expensive than floating glass, but it is usually less expensive than replacing the whole panel.

Repairing a glass window can range anywhere from $75 to $300, based on the size of damage, material, and design. If you're not comfortable with DIY projects, you can also engage a glass repair company to fix the window for you. A single-pane glass window will cost less to repair. Depending on the type window you have replacing the glass block could save you hundreds of bucks per year. Experts estimate that as much as 30% of energy loss can be caused by poor quality window frames and thin glass panes. It is best to select windows with reflective Low-E coatings and argon filled glass, energy-efficient glass.
It can be costly to replace sliding glass doors. Replacement glass costs range between $100-$600 per panel.
